I'm running into the same error while attempting to compile Python 3.8.1 on Ubuntu 18.04. The actual test failure is this: ====================================================================== FAIL: test_errors_in_command (test.test_pdb.PdbTestCase) ---------------------------------------------------------------------- Traceback (most recent call last): File "/opt/Python-3.8.1/Lib/test/test_pdb.py", line 1580, in test_errors_in_command self.assertEqual(stdout.splitlines()[1:], [ AssertionError: Lists differ: ['(Pd[283 chars]efined", 'LEAVING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', '(Pdb) ', '\x1b[?1034h'] != ['(Pd[283 chars]efined", 'LEAVING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', '(Pdb) '] First list contains 1 additional elements. First extra element 9: '\x1b[?1034h' ['(Pdb) *** SyntaxError: unexpected EOF while parsing', '(Pdb) ENTERING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', '*** SyntaxError: unexpected EOF while parsing', 'LEAVING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', '(Pdb) ENTERING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', '> <string>(1)<module>()', "((Pdb)) *** NameError: name 'doesnotexist' is not defined", 'LEAVING RECURSIVE DEBUGGER', - '(Pdb) ', ? ^ + '(Pdb) '] ? ^ - '\x1b[?1034h'] ---------------------------------------------------------------------- This failure only appeared after I installed additional packages and attempted to reconfigure and reinstall.
